Serves 1
What do I need?
1 tender banana
2 tbsp peanut butter


How do I do?
Peel the banana, slice it and throw it in the freezer for 10 minutes. It doesn't have to be completely frozen, but if it is, your blender needs to be the powerful kind.
Blend the banana slices and peanutbutter and add a bit more peanutbutter if you'd like.
